Karen Bass heads to LA mayoral runoff after falling short of majority
Incumbent comes out on top in primary election – but with less than 50% of votes – and will take on challenger in November
Karen Bass has come out ahead in Tuesday’s heated primary for Los Angeles mayor, but with less than 50% of the vote will have to defend her seat in November’s general election.
Bass will face either Spencer Pratt, a former reality TV star, or city council member Nithya Raman, in November. As of Tuesday evening, it was still unclear who would move on.
